# Approvals — WS Reconnect Fix

Scope: patch for the websocket reconnect bug in Tinderbox Relay where stale session tokens caused reconnect storms after broker failover. Fix adds jittered backoff and token refresh before handshake. Reviewers: check the backoff cap (30s) and the new integration test in relay_reconnect_spec. Merge requires one approval from platform plus sign-off by:

named custodian: Belius Casath Ulaix Sorius

Ticket: Pagination config drift between API nodes

Several plugin authors report inconsistent page sizes from the Wrenfold public REST API: some nodes return 50 items per page, others 100, and cursor expiry differs too. Root cause is config drift — two nodes were rebuilt last month and picked up stale values. Until the fleet is reconciled, plugins should not assume a fixed page size. The intended canonical values are recorded below.

deployment values, fafog-fawip:
[jorox]
team = fendor
access_code = ac_bb00ea
host = jorox.qorveltech.internal
port = 9200
owner = istdor.aldeth
peer = julvan.orvexlabs.internal

Handover: export retries. Failed Ledgerpond exports land in the `export_dlq` table with a reason code. Safe to retry anything coded T01–T04; never retry V-codes without checking with finance ops first. Use the `requeue` script, batch size 50 max, and watch the worker logs for ten minutes after. The retry procedure and code reference are on the internal page here:

operations page: https://jenkins.zemvarcloud.local/job/merge_requests/repo/build/73930b4b30f0a8ed